Biography and education
Jose holds a Master of Arts degree in Spanish and a dual Bachelor of Arts degree in History and Spanish from Texas State University. Jose completed a master’s thesis focusing on the evolution of the Spanish language as well as the use of regionalisms in both folk and popular songs from the borderlands of the Rio Grande Valley in Deep South Texas and northern Mexico.
Jose is a member of the National Hispanic Honor Society, Sigma Delta Pi.
